Global Citizen’s Recovery Plan for the World campaign will call on the international community to get us back on track to achieving the Global Goals by 2030 by advocating for an equitable global COVID-19 recovery plan. The Global Goals, established in 2015, set out to end extreme poverty by ending hunger, achieving good health for all, ensuring every child has access to education, fighting climate change, and reducing inequalities.
